How to implement privacy-preserving browser analytics that aggregate data while preventing exposure of individual behaviors.
A practical guide outlining architecture, techniques, and governance practices for collecting anonymized browser metrics without revealing personal patterns or identifiable traces.
July 22, 2025
Facebook X Reddit
Browsers generate a torrent of user interactions every day, from page loads and scroll depth to click paths and timing patterns. Traditional analytics systems often struggle to balance usefulness with privacy, risking exposure of specific sessions or unique behavior. This article presents a cohesive framework for privacy-preserving analytics, focusing on aggregate signals that inform product decisions while locking down individual traces. It emphasizes principled data minimization, nondeterministic sampling, and cryptographic safeguards. By separating data collection from analysis, teams can prevent inadvertent leakage while still surfacing meaningful trends, performance hotspots, and compatibility issues across diverse user cohorts.
The architecture begins with client-side instrumentation that emits minimal, non-identifying signals. Crucially, every metric is designed to be non-reversible at the point of collection; raw events never leave the device in their original form. Data is batched, aggregated, and aligned with a clear taxonomy before transmission. The server side then implements strict access controls, separation of duties, and audit trails to ensure only authorized processes can view summary results. This layered approach reduces exposure risk and helps establish a culture of privacy by default, where each artifact of measurement is considered transient and purposely anonymized as a first principle.
Techniques to aggregate data while protecting individual identities
A cornerstone is data minimization, which means capturing only what is necessary to answer the analysis questions. Designers should distinguish between signals that quantify broad behavior and those that could reveal an individual’s routine or preferences. Employing probabilistic data structures, such as Bloom filters or count-min sketches, allows counting occurrences while masking precise values. Complementary approaches include k-anonymity and differential privacy at the data-collection or aggregation stage, enabling robust protections against re-identification when data sets are merged. Establishing clear retention limits ensures stale information does not linger, reducing risk without forfeiting long-term trend visibility.
ADVERTISEMENT
ADVERTISEMENT
Transparency with users remains essential, even in privacy-centric analytics. Clear disclosures about what is measured, how it is aggregated, and how long data persists build trust. Organizations should offer opt-in and opt-out choices that are meaningful, not merely ceremonial, and provide accessible explanations of potential identifiability under various data-sharing scenarios. Governance should define the minimum viable data set for core product goals, along with escalation paths when privacy boundaries are challenged by new features. Regular privacy impact assessments help teams foresee risks early, aligning product experimentation with ethical standards and legal obligations.
Practical guardrails that keep analytics aligned with user rights
The aggregation layer should operate on already-summarized inputs rather than raw events whenever feasible. Designed correctly, this layer produces metrics such as regional performance ranges, feature adoption curves, and average latency clusters, without exposing individual sessions. Noise addition, whether via randomized response or carefully calibrated differential privacy budgets, ensures that tiny groups cannot be traced back to real users. The system must enforce strict thresholds so that metrics with very small denominators do not reveal user counts, thereby preventing potential re-identification. Such safeguards are essential when analyzing rarely occurring events or niche configurations.
ADVERTISEMENT
ADVERTISEMENT
Secure multi-party computation provides another avenue for privacy-preserving analytics. In scenarios where data collaboration across organizations or domains is necessary, teams can compute joint statistics without sharing raw observations. Federated learning concepts reinforce this principle by updating models locally and only exchanging aggregated updates. Implementations should minimize cross-border data movement and comply with jurisdictional restrictions. Protocols must be designed to resist inference attacks and timing leaks, which can indirectly reveal user attributes. When combined with robust access controls, these methods enable broader insights while maintaining strict boundaries around individual data.
Governance, policy, and accountability in browser analytics
Consent mechanisms and user rights must be integrated into every stage of the analytics lifecycle. This includes providing straightforward ways to view, modify, or withdraw consent, and ensuring that data processing respects those choices. It also entails offering clear pathways to data portability for users who wish to export or retract their information. From a technical standpoint, automatic deletion schedules, verifiable data erasure, and non-retention guarantees help reduce the attack surface. Regular audits verify compliance with internal policies and external regulations, while incident response plans prepare teams to address any breach promptly and transparently.
Performance signals should not be conflated with personally identifying details. For example, measuring page load times or error rates across cohorts yields valuable engineering insight without exposing specific user journeys. Implementing cohort-based analytics rather than per-user logs shifts the focus to generalizable patterns. It’s important to design dashboards that showcase aggregated trends, confidence intervals, and anomaly alerts, rather than raw traces. This emphasis on aggregate visibility helps product teams identify bottlenecks, optimize resource allocation, and guide feature prioritization without compromising privacy.
ADVERTISEMENT
ADVERTISEMENT
Putting theory into practice with real-world implementation
A formal governance model defines roles, responsibilities, and decision rights for data practices. It should codify privacy objectives, data-handling standards, and escalation points for potential violations. Policy documents need to be living artifacts, regularly revisited to reflect evolving technologies and user expectations. Accountability requires independent reviews, strict separation of duties, and a culture that encourages reporting concerns without fear of retaliation. When stakeholders understand who can access what data and under which circumstances, it strengthens trust and ensures consistent application of privacy-preserving methods across teams.
Data lineage and provenance are critical for traceability. Recording the origin, transformation, and deletion of each metric helps ensure accountability and facilitates debugging when questions arise about certain aggregates. Automated tooling can map data flows from collection through processing to visualization, highlighting where privacy protections are implemented and where exceptions might exist. Proactive monitoring alerts, coupled with reproducible experiments, enable teams to verify that privacy guarantees hold under fresh deployments and changing user patterns.
Start with a minimal pilot program that tests privacy safeguards in a controlled environment. Select representative scenarios, such as feature usage across regions or compatibility with popular devices, and measure the impact of privacy techniques on analytic usefulness. Gather feedback from stakeholders on data quality, latency, and interpretability of results. Iterate rapidly, tightening privacy budgets where necessary and removing any data points that approach exposure thresholds. Document lessons learned, including which techniques provided the most reliable signals without compromising privacy, and use them to inform broader rollouts.
The long-term success of privacy-preserving analytics rests on continuous improvement and education. Invest in training for engineers, product managers, and privacy professionals to stay current with techniques like differential privacy, secure aggregation, and federated computation. Foster collaboration with privacy advocates and legal experts to maintain alignment with evolving laws and standards. Finally, cultivate a culture that views privacy as a competitive advantage, not a checkbox, by measuring not only performance but also trust, user satisfaction, and the responsible stewardship of data throughout the analytics lifecycle.
Related Articles
A practical guide for developers to design resilient service workers, implement secure lifecycle policies, and prevent lingering failures or stale assets from affecting user experiences across modern browsers.
July 14, 2025
Designing a browser-centered user research plan requires privacy by design, ethical recruitment, rigorous consent processes, and methods that yield practical, actionable insights without compromising participant anonymity or data security across diverse web environments.
August 08, 2025
This evergreen guide details practical, proven strategies to harden browser-based remote access tools and web consoles, ensuring strong authentication, encrypted sessions, vigilant monitoring, and resilient configurations for critical infrastructure.
July 29, 2025
Choosing a browser with energy efficiency in mind involves comparing CPU activity, memory usage, and background tasks across popular options, then testing real-world battery impact while considering features that support power-saving workflows and user privacy.
July 28, 2025
A practical guide on turning on browser password managers, choosing encryption keys wisely, and maintaining ongoing control, with emphasis on security, privacy, and user autonomy across popular browsers.
July 18, 2025
Designing browser UX patterns that encourage secure actions while preserving smooth, efficient workflows requires thoughtful balance, empirical testing, and user-centered refinements that respect privacy, speed, and ease of use.
July 26, 2025
This guide explores pairing browser password managers with hardware-backed security keys, detailing setup, workflow, and best practices to achieve resilient authentication without sacrificing user experience or speed.
July 23, 2025
Designers and developers craft robust storage schemas for progressive web apps to seamlessly function offline, synchronize securely, and preserve user privacy while maintaining performance across diverse networks and devices.
July 16, 2025
As organizations move testing left, integrating browser security checks into continuous integration ensures early detection, reduces risk, and fosters a culture of secure development by validating code, configurations, and dependencies before they reach production environments.
July 15, 2025
A practical guide to setting up browser-level debugging that helps you detect memory leaks, long tasks, and heavy CPU scripts across popular engines with minimal overhead and clear, actionable results.
August 08, 2025
A practical, evergreen guide detailing strategies to guard embedded API keys and tokens in single-page apps, emphasizing rotation, minimization, protection, and resilient design for long-term security.
July 31, 2025
In a diverse browser landscape, developers can ensure reliable experiences by starting with essential functionality and progressively layering enhancements that gracefully degrade when advanced features are unavailable across platforms and devices, enabling robust, accessible web interfaces.
July 31, 2025
A practical, privacy-minded guide to building a dedicated browser profile, studying delicate subjects with minimized data leakage, stronger safeguards, and disciplined habits that reduce telltale footprints across devices and networks.
July 23, 2025
In today’s enterprise landscape, enforcing strict browser policies helps safeguard sensitive data by limiting exports, monitoring sharing channels, and centralizing control for IT teams across devices and platforms.
July 18, 2025
Browsers offer autofill and predictive suggestions that speed up browsing, yet they can expose sensitive details. Learn practical steps to preserve privacy, control data sharing, and reduce risk while still enjoying the convenience of autofill features across devices and sites.
July 30, 2025
As organizations scale across departments and tenants, aligning privacy controls across diverse browsers becomes essential to protect data, maintain compliance, and deliver a uniform user experience while minimizing risk and administrative overhead.
July 19, 2025
Designing a robust, repeatable workflow for payment integrations in browser sandboxes minimizes risk, preserves data privacy, and ensures compliant, verifiable testing through structured processes and verifiable controls.
August 08, 2025
A thorough, evergreen guide that helps readers assess browser security capabilities, privacy protections, and architectural safeguards essential for safely handling confidential financial interactions online.
July 25, 2025
Protecting your online life starts with disciplined browser security routines. This guide outlines practical, durable steps to safeguard saved passwords and autofill data, spanning device hygiene, authentication choices, and privacy-aware browsing practices that stand up to evolving threats.
August 04, 2025
A practical, scalable guide to building a design system that remains visually consistent across browsers while meeting accessibility standards, including proactive testing, semantic markup, and inclusive styling practices.
August 08, 2025